Convergence: State of Climate Blended Finance 2025

2025-11-28T14:10:22+01:00

The report examines global trends in mobilizing private investment for climate action, with 2024 marking USD 15.5 billion across 84 deals—the second-highest level in six years. The report highlights strong institutional investor participation, a continued focus on mitigation, and shifting regional dynamics in climate finance.
